ACBR Veteran Members and Industry Legends Honored at Luncheon

ATLANTA, GA – June 5, 2015 – (RealEstateRama) — Bruce Wilson, Charlie Brown, Jack Rooker, Larry Kelly, Sam Massell and Steve Selig were honored by the Atlanta Commercial Board of REALTORS® during an intimate luncheon for their video contributions to the ACBR 2015 Million Dollar Club awards.

The luncheon was held on Wednesday, May 27th, at Cherokee Town and Country Club and included fine cuisine, legendary stories and talks about life as a commercial real estate practitioner in the Atlanta market and their road to success. The Atlanta commercial real estate industry is a unique community with competitors who are also such close friends. ABOUT THE ATLANTA COMMERCIAL BOARD OF REALTORS®:
The Atlanta Commercial Board of REALTORS® (ACBR) is the voice of commercial real estate in Metro Atlanta and has been an instrumental factor in the growth of real estate in the state of Georgia for more than a century. As the only Commercial REALTOR® Association in Georgia, ACBR serves as a central source of information for its members by focusing on real estate education, the promotion of professionalism in the industry and representing members with legislative initiatives to create positive change for the real estate community. Membership in ACBR is the hallmark of quality, professionalism and production.
